Lindsay, D. M. and McArthur, D. (2010) The synthesis of chiral N-heterocyclic carbene–borane and –diorganoborane complexes and their use in the asymmetric reduction of ketones. Chemical Communications, 46 (14). pp. 2474-2476. ISSN 1359-7345 doi: 10.1039/C001466D
Abstract/Summary
Chiral N-heterocyclic carbene–borane complexes have been synthesised, and have been shown to reduce ketones with Lewis acid promotion. Chiral N-heterocyclic carbene–borane and –diorganoborane complexes can reduce ketones with enantioselectivities up to 75% and 85% ee, respectively.
